A Sentimental Journey through France and Italy
A travelogue by the English novelist L. Sterne. Published in 1768. It is an emotional travelogue, completely different in style from the typical travelogues of the time, which described nature, scenery and facts. It covers Calais, Rouen, Paris, Bourbonnais and Lyon, but the description of Italy, as mentioned in the title, is missing because the author died of illness and it ended in two volumes. It is based on the author's travels for medical treatment (1765-66), but is written not in accordance with his illness or his actions, but rather with the author's emotional reactions to specific events, and the nature of leisure is emphasized throughout the work.
